If any of the following conditions is true, the trouble
codes in memory will not erase.
l
When the stop light switch is not ON before
the ignition switch is set to ON
l
When the first stop light switch input change
(ON-OFF) does not occur in less than three
seconds, or when the second and subsequent
change does not occur in less than one second
l
When the generator terminal L voltage goes
“HI” before erasure is completed

Data List Output
Of the ABS-ECU
input data, the following items can be read by the scan tool.
1. When the System is in Order
Code No.
Items
Displayed unit
11
Front right wheel speed
km/H
12
Front left wheel speed
km/H
13
Rear right wheel speed
km/H
14
Rear left wheel speed
km/H
21
ABS-ECU power voltage
22
Generator power voltage
23
Stop light switch ON/OFF state
ON/OFF

Part name
Wheel speed sensor
No.
Function
1
Sends an AC signal with a frequency proportional to the ro-
tating speed of the individual wheel to the ABS-ECU.
Sensor
G-sensor
2
Sends an ON/OFF signal to the ABS-ECU depending on
vehicle acceleration/deceleration.
Stop light switch
3
Sends a signal to the ABS-ECU indicating whether the
brake pedal is pressed or not.
Actuator
Hydraulic unit (HU)
ABS power relay
Motor relay
Valve relay
Controls braking pressure for each wheel depending on the
4
signal from the ABS-ECU.
Includes built-in select-low valve
5
Supplies power to the ABS-ECU.
6
Closes contact in response to a signal from the ABS-ECU to
allow the power to be supplied to the motor in the HU.
7
Is turned ON by the ABS-ECU signal and supplies power to
the solenoid valve in HU.
ABS warning light
8
Is in the combination meter and lights up when there is
trouble in ABS.
Data link connector
Electronic control unit (ECU)
9
Outputs diagnostic trouble codes.
10
Controls the actuators such as HU according to the signals
from the individual sensors.
